Lemon Pepper Chicken Wings are a perfect balance of tangy lemon and spicy pepper, creating a crispy and flavorful snack. Simple to prepare and great for any occasion.

Ingredients
900gChicken Wings
1tbspOlive Oil
2tspLemon PepperSeasoning
1tspGarlic Powder
1tspPaprika
1tbspLemon JuiceFresh
½tspSalt
¼tspBlack Pepper
ParsleyFresh, optional, for garnish
Instructions
Preheat your oven to 200°C (180°C fan) or 400°F.
Place the chicken wings in a large mixing bowl and drizzle with olive oil. Toss to coat evenly.
Sprinkle the lemon pepper seasoning,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per over the chicken wings. Toss again to ensure the wings are well-coated in the seasoning mix.
Drizzle the fresh lemon juice over the seasoned wings and give them one final toss.
Arrange the wings in a single layer on a baking tray lined with parchment paper.
Bake the chicken wings for 25-30 minutes, or until they are golden and crispy.
Gar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ving.
